有什么明确的方法可以指定使用vba函数吗?

时间:2018-10-16 07:00:08

标签: excel vba excel-vba

快速提问。有什么方法可以明确指出我想使用excel VBA函数而不是用户定义的函数。

例如,在我的方案中,我具有此基本功能,

Function Month(myMonth, myMonthText)
    Select Case myMonth
        Case "Jan"
            myMonthText = "January"
        Case "Feb"
            myMonthText = "February"
        Case "Mar"
            myMonthText = "March"
        Case "Apr"
            myMonthText = "April"
        Case "May"
            myMonthText = "May"
        Case "Jun"
            myMonthText = "June"
        Case "Jul"
            myMonthText = "July"
        Case "Aug"
            myMonthText = "August"
        Case "Sep"
            myMonthText = "September"
        Case "Oct"
            myMonthText = "October"
        Case "Nov"
            myMonthText = "November"
        Case "Dec"
            myMonthText = "December"
        Case Else
            myMonthText = "Error"
    End Select
End Function

该功能以名称“ Month”定义。 VBA有其自己的Month函数,该函数返回月的数字值。如果有一个用户定义的函数,其名称与现有的vba函数重叠,则如何明确告诉我要使用现有的vba函数。

我知道我可以重命名用户定义的函数,以便它不会与VBA函数重叠,并且一切都会很好,但是想知道是否有一种方法可以使其在这种情况下工作

0 个答案:

没有答案